Okay so I needed to go to the AAA club in Irvine, I wanted to get something to eat nearby. So I went to Cafe Rio, although I generally prefer to get my tacos at alebrijes off of Cubbon and main Street in Santa Ana. Like I always say the prices and quality of the food is the best... outside of Irvine. So I ordered the Thursday special which is shrimp tacos with beans and rice. The the flower tortillas were really well done and the shrimp was ample. Yes for the cilantro no for the chopped onions or cactus. They provided a mango salsa on the side. The black beans were as expected, but the rice was undercooked. I had to mix the rice with the black beans in order to soften up the rice. The shrimp was in a coconut flake coating and then deep fried. The coconut was on the sweet type so it was very tasty. If I had more self control I could have been just one of the two tacos and save the other one for dinner. That's how big each one was. Ok, so not to bad for Irvine but I'll stick with my tacos at alebrijes
